python-工作中用到的点

目录

调用http接口

调用C++库

查看训练模型文件中内容


调用http接口

import json
import requests

params = {
    "vectorName": "zhangsan8",
    "vectorContent": [[1, 2]]
}
# 将 vectorContent 转换为字符串
params["vectorContent"] = json.dumps(params["vectorContent"], separators=(",", ":"))
data1 = json.dumps(params)

url = "http://192.168.0.157:8084/vector/reg"
response = requests.post(url, data=json.dumps(params), headers={'Content-Type': 'application/json'})
# 解析JSON响应数据
result = response.json()  
# 对结果进行处理或解析
print(result)

调用C++库

import ctypes

# Dll1.dll 文件在项目的根目录
cpp_lib = ctypes.CDLL("../Dll1.dll")
# AddJna为Dll库中的函数,区分大小写,需要完全匹配
result = cpp_lib.AddJna()
print(result)

查看训练模型文件中内容

import pickle

f = open('D:\\demo.pkl', 'rb')
data = pickle.load(f)
print(data)

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值